Three-time biathlon world champion Ivan Cherezov spoke about the death of the ex-biathlete Igor Malinovsky .
On Sunday, the Russian Biathlon Union (RBU) confirmed that Malinovsky died in a helicopter crash in Kamchatka. He was 25 years old.
– He is a guy from Kamchatka, especially since he loved the sky, he studied at the helicopter school. It is clear that it was his love, his passion, just like biathlon, probably. But in biathlon he showed excellent results as a junior. Well, and, probably, now he was drawn to the sky. In addition, the opportunity was to fly.
Such an open, bright guy with a beautiful smile. He was, in my opinion, the absolute world champion. Few of our biathletes can boast of such a result and such talent. He was the best junior in his life. Yeah, it didn’t work out in big sport. It’s a pity, of course, it’s an immense misfortune, a great sorrow. First of all, of course, for the family, for relatives and friends, and for us, for the world of biathlon, – RBC Sport quotes Cherezov.
